Hey

I have a form set up to enter geological data for individual drillholes. All information on the form is referenced to a query.

On the form is a combo box listing the site name. The site name comes from my Site_Info table, which is linked by a one-to-many relationship to my Drillhole_info table (So one site can have more than one drillhole). I'd like to be able to add a site to the combo box as the user is filling in drillhole information, but the old 'Limit to List' has me stumped.

The combo box is set up to show the second column of the table (the site name), but is bound by the first column (the site identifier). I'd like to be able to type in the site name and generate the identifier.

Can someone point me towards an old post, a help file, or tell me how this works and how I can get around it!
